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面。GitHub则是一个流行的代码托管平台,广泛用于版本控制和协作。结合Markdown和GitHub,开发者可以轻松地创建和分享文档,展示代码,并进行高效的团队协作。本文将详细介绍如何掌握Markdown和GitHub,以提升文档协作与代码展示的技巧。
一、Markdown基础
1.1 常用语法
标题:使用
#符号创建标题,#的数量决定标题的层级。# 一级标题 ## 二级标题 ### 三级标题段落:直接输入文本即可创建段落,段落之间需要空行分隔。
加粗和斜体:使用
**包裹文本创建加粗,使用*包裹文本创建斜体。**加粗文本** *斜体文本*列表:使用
-、*或+符号创建无序列表,使用数字创建有序列表。 “`markdown- 无序列表项1
- 无序列表项2
- 无序列表项3
- 有序列表项1
- 有序列表项2
- 有序列表项3
”`
链接:使用
[链接文本](链接地址)创建链接。[GitHub](https://github.com)图片:使用
插入图片。表格:使用竖线
|分隔表格列,使用短横线-分隔列标题和内容。| 表头1 | 表头2 | 表头3 | | --- | --- | --- | | 内容1 | 内容2 | 内容3 |
1.2 高级技巧
- 代码块:使用三个反引号
`包裹代码块,指定语言即可高亮显示。markdownpython print("Hello, world!")“ - 引用:使用
>符号创建引用。> 引用文本
二、GitHub协作
2.1 帐户注册与项目创建
- 在GitHub官网注册帐户。
- 创建一个新的仓库(Repository),选择适当的项目类型(Public或Private)。
- 设置仓库的描述和许可信息。
2.2 版本控制
GitHub基于Git进行版本控制,以下是基本操作:
- 克隆仓库:使用
git clone 仓库地址将远程仓库克隆到本地。 - 查看状态:使用
git status查看当前仓库的状态。 - 添加文件:使用
git add 文件名将文件添加到暂存区。 - 提交更改:使用
git commit -m "提交信息"将更改提交到本地仓库。 - 推送更改:使用
git push将更改推送到远程仓库。
2.3 分支管理
- 创建分支:使用
git checkout -b 新分支名创建并切换到新分支。 - 合并分支:使用
git merge 分支名将分支合并到当前分支。
2.4 Pull Request
- 创建Pull Request:在GitHub上创建一个新的Pull Request,选择要合并的分支。
- 代码审查:其他成员可以评论和审查你的代码,提出修改建议。
- 合并代码:审核通过后,点击“Merge pull request”合并代码。
三、Markdown与GitHub结合应用
3.1 创建文档
- 在GitHub仓库中创建一个Markdown文件,如
README.md。 - 使用Markdown语法编写文档内容。
- 提交并推送更改,文档即可在GitHub仓库中展示。
3.2 展示代码
- 在GitHub仓库中创建代码文件。
- 使用代码块语法在Markdown文件中引用代码。
- 提交并推送更改,代码即可在Markdown文档中展示。
3.3 团队协作
- 多人协作:团队成员可以在各自的分支上开发代码,合并时使用Pull Request进行审查。
- 分支策略:使用主分支(Master)存放生产环境代码,其他分支用于开发新功能或修复bug。
- 文档共享:团队成员可以在Markdown文件中协作编写文档,提高团队沟通效率。
四、总结
掌握Markdown和GitHub是现代开发者必备的技能。通过本文的介绍,相信你已经对Markdown和GitHub的基本操作有了深入了解。在实际应用中,结合Markdown和GitHub可以提升文档协作和代码展示的效率,为团队协作和项目开发带来更多便利。不断实践和探索,你将发现更多Markdown和GitHub的强大功能。
